Marie‐Paule Besland is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Marie‐Paule Besland has authored 86 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 66 papers in Electrical and Electronic Engineering, 58 papers in Materials Chemistry and 15 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Marie‐Paule Besland’s work include Semiconductor materials and devices (18 papers), Advanced Memory and Neural Computing (16 papers) and ZnO doping and properties (14 papers). Marie‐Paule Besland is often cited by papers focused on Semiconductor materials and devices (18 papers), Advanced Memory and Neural Computing (16 papers) and ZnO doping and properties (14 papers). Marie‐Paule Besland collaborates with scholars based in France, China and Germany. Marie‐Paule Besland's co-authors include Étienne Janod, Laurent Cario, B. Corraze, Julien Tranchant and Pierre‐Yves Tessier and has published in prestigious journals such as Physical Review Letters, Journal of the American Chemical Society and Applied Physics Letters.
